Afghanistan's star cricketer Rashid Khan has expressed his frustration over the cancellation of his team's upcoming matches. The talented leg-spinner took to social media to voice his frustration, stating that the decision was a setback for the development of cricket in Afghanistan.

The Afghanistan Cricket Board (ACB) recently announced that several planned matches had to be called off due to undisclosed reasons. This news came as a blow to the Afghan cricket team, which has been making steady progress in the international arena over the past few years.

Rashid Khan, who has become a global sensation with his exceptional bowling skills, emphasized the importance of regular matches for the growth and exposure of Afghan cricketers. He emphasized that playing against top-tier teams is essential for the team's growth and to demonstrate their skills on the global stage.

The cancellation of matches not only affects the players but also the passionate cricket fans in Afghanistan. Cricket has become a uniting force in the country, uniting people and providing a sense of fulfillment and happiness despite difficult circumstances.

The ACB has not given comprehensive reasons for the cancellations, causing fans and players to speculate about the underlying problems. Some have raised concerns about the impact of political instability and security challenges on the sport's development in Afghanistan.

Despite the setback, Rashid Khan and his teammates remain committed to their craft and are determined to overcome this hurdle. They have urged cricket authorities and interested parties to assist Afghanistan cricket and guarantee that the team gets sufficient chances to play at the highest level.

The cricketing world has rallied behind Afghanistan, with many players and fans expressing their solidarity and hope for a swift resolution. The International Cricket Council (ICC) has also been urged to intervene and facilitate the smooth conduct of Afghanistan's cricket matches.

As Afghanistan's cricket team eagerly awaits the resumption of their international matches, Rashid Khan's frustration serves as an indication of the difficulties encountered by developing cricketing nations. The cricket community remains hopeful that the issues will be resolved soon, allowing Afghanistan to continue its cricketing journey and inspire a new generation of players.
